Mental pressure is a kind of demand or threat. When we feel threatened, our nervous system responds by releasing a flood of stress hormones, including adrenaline and cortisol, which rouse the body for emergency action. Hearts starts to pounds faster, muscles tighten, blood pressure rises, breathe quickens and senses become sharper.

Mental pressure interferes with judgement and cause to make bad decisions. It reduces enjoyment and make us feel bad. Not only this it makes us anxious, frustrated or mad. In addition to this, unable to laugh, afraid of free time, unable to work and not willing to discuss problems with others are other problem created by mental pressure.There is some preventive measure to avoid mental pressure. 

Try to express feelings instead of bottling them up. Have a will to compromise, manage your better time. We can also reframe problem and look at the big picture. In addition to this we can also go for a walk, spend time in nature, call a good friend, write a journal and take a long bath.
